OTHER J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
1- M aterial Management
Work closely with Suppliers, Transportation, HQ Material Management, and Procurement group to ensure materials are not shorted for production via use of processes to confirm order receipts at the suppliers, and their acknowledgement of delivering on our required date and quantity.
Ensure of a process and relationship with suppliers where they proactively and timely report any production or shipping/carrier issues, and enlist supplier, Trans or HQ help to preempt any threat of shortage.
Execute Change Notifications, ordering the new materials & exiting the old as the Change Notifications direct.
Coordinate with warehouse receiving as materials come in to ensure timely receipt of ingredients are physically in the system. Monitor the receiving process for timely entry into SAP.
Ensure timely and accurate submission of data to manufacturing applications (SAP) to update changes in orders and inventory of materials. Keep SAP accurate in real time.
Responsible for bulk cargo delivery schedule updates to accommodate changes in the production schedule, perform status checks to validate the capacity of silos/tanks, and manage silo/tanks and storage space for receipt of materials. This includes the yearly silo cleaning process.
2- Quality
When obsolete and/or unusable materials are on site, manage the identification and coordination of the destruction or movement of materials. This includes coordinating bulk evacuation if necessary.
Manage quality holds and the inventory shelf-life. Execute vendor complaints & returns for credit for quality reject materials.
3- Inventory
Coordinate & execute inventory Cycle Counts weekly with posting and root cause analysis the variances.
Monitor and manage the capacity and CSX yard management.
Provide information and analysis on inventory of materials to support the decision-making process related to the management of inventory levels and risk/opportunity management. Proposal actions to avoid using expired or obsolete materials &/or request for exception with Quality accordingly.
4) Warehouse
Involved in all materials warehouse projects/initiatives (cost savings, renovations, ramp-ups, flexibility projects, plant trials, etc) through cross-functional support and Lean Six Sigma methodology to provide continuous improvement in the processes and procedures for the facility.
Assist with general warehouse supervision and management. Especially regarding daily audits and checks.
Back-up for other staff positions within Warehouse team
